Transaction 6e4c81fee671d7106e5789b4f81a0a134a33d94edfddb382da6b5b5d249613c3
1 Input
1 Output
-
6e4c81fee671d7106e5789b4f81a0a134a33d94edfddb382da6b5b5d249613c3:0
- value
- 43851
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ba9dbb6289fd0a7d3c13a676116b23269d656163 OP_EQUAL
- address
- 3JhkZdiHxhUds8UK5xNr3Zgy8T4LZNc6H6